Providence Medical Group to Become First Large-Scale Patient Centered Medical Home in Dayton, Ohio

Providence Medical Group in Dayton, Ohio, is on the fast track to becoming the first patient-centered medical home in the city.

An affiliation with GE Aviation, which recently brought a number of jobs to Dayton, has helped speed up the PCMH accreditation process. And cardiovascular imaging test are done on-site by Diagnostic Partners, a cardiologist-owned company that helps physicians and administrators nationwide, which helps make integrated care more convenient for Providence Medical Group.  

The Medical Group is Dayton’s only major healthcare provider organization independently owned and managed by physicians.
